Publisher's Synopsis

Die Haussklaverei in Ostafrika ist eine historische und politische Studie über die Sklaverei in Ostafrika im 19. Jahrhundert. Fritz Weidner beschreibt die verschiedenen Formen der Sklaverei, ihre Auswirkungen auf die Gesellschaft und die politischen Hintergründe dieser Praxis. Seine Arbeit ist ein wichtiger Beitrag zur Geschichte der Sklaverei in Afrika und zur Debatte über moderne Formen der Zwangsarbeit.
